YESTERDAY I TOOK MY CAR (2002 si ) TO THE CAR WASH AFTER THEY FINISHED WASHING I SAW THAT THE "SRS" ON THE DASHBOARD WAS ON, SO I IGNORE IT CAUSE I THOUGHT THAT THE BULB JUST DIDNT WORK BUT TODAY I ASKED THE GUY THAT DOES THE OIL CHENGES FOR ME HE SAID THAT MAYBE THAT'S ON BECAUSE ONE OF THEM WET THE SIT CAUSE THE SEAT HAS SIDE AIR BAGS , IS THAT TRUE? OR WHAT DO YOU THINK GUYS? IVE NEVER RECKED THA CAR BEFORE . ILL APPRECIATE SOME ANSWERS HERE.
there are many different things that could cause that.. just wetting the seat is HIGHLY unlikely... but i suggest taking it to the dealer.. because even if they charge you, it's better than the damn airbag goin' off in your face while goin' down the road at 90..... plus, i think airbags have a special warranty period so they really shouldn't charge you anything for checking it out
Yea Honda Has A Life Time Warranty On The Seat Belts And Some Times The Tensioners Go Bad Which Will Cause That, Also Make Sure You Dont Have Anything Laying On The Seats Such As Books Or Something With Some Kind Of Decent Wait Cause That Can Make Them Come On As Well
Yea At The Worst Man They Will Charge You For 1 Hour Check Out To Pull The Srs Diagnostic Trouble Code With The Honda Diagnostic Scanner, And If Its A Problem Covered Under Warranty They Will Waive The Check Out Fee To Warranty As Well.
